The Des Moines Register
Des Moines, Iowa
Tuesday, November 29, 1960
Page 18, Column 8

Carl Ackelson Rites Wednesday

Services for Carl E. Ackelson, 63, of 311 S. E. Fourteenth st., who died of cancer Sunday at Veterans Hospital here, will be at 10:30 a. m. Wednesday at Hamilton's Funeral Home. Burial will be at Highland Memory Gardens.

Born at Winterset, he had lived here 45 years and had been employed as a hoisting, engineer. He served in World War I and was a member of Engineers Local 234.

Survivors are his wife, Edna, of Des Moines; a daughter, Mrs. Hazel Ferguson of Des Moines; two sons, Harold E. of Santee, Cal., and Richard C. of San Francisco, Cal.; three sisters, Verdie Ackelson of South Bend, Ind., Edna Wilkinson of Kansas City, Kan., and Clarkie Cleghorn of Des Moines; five brothers, Edgar, John, and Leo of Des Moines, Vernon E. of Twin Falls, Idaho, and George of West Virginia; and five grandchildren.
